One gold and two silver medals in Spain for wines produced at Vinea Apoldia Maior

Our university was awarded, on February 28, 2024, with the gold medal in Spain, in Vitoria-Gasteiz, for the Sauvignon Blanc Aurum Terras 2023, respectively with the silver medals for Muscat Ottonel Aurum Terras 2023 and Sauvignon Blanc Aurum Terras 2022! All are produced at the Vinea Apoldia Maior winery and we thus congratulate our colleagues!

The first gold medal at international level was won by our university also at the Catavinum World Wine & Spirits Competition, in 2023, for the Sauvignon Blanc label of 2022.

The Catavinum World Wine & Spirits Competition ran from 15-25 February and the results were announced on 28 February 2024. According to the organisers, almost 3,000 wine labels from more than 20 countries were entered in the annual competition in Vitoria-Gasteisz.

Since 2020, USAMV Cluj-Napoca coordinates the Vinea Apoldia Maior Viticultural Station (Apoldu de Sus, Sibiu county), which is dedicated to university education and research. Professors and students are involved in the development of modern technologies for vine cultivation, wine production, superior valorisation of wine by-products and the development of agritourism.
